越来越多的普通程序员在应对35岁职业危机的时候,毫不犹豫的选择转行产品经理,技术转岗产品经理,有着本身不可忽视的优势。
技术转岗产品经理的优势主要体现在以下几个方面:
1、强大的逻辑能力:
技术人员通常具备严谨的编程思维,这种逻辑性可以很好地带入到产品经理的工作中。在产品设计、需求分析、功能规划等环节,逻辑能力强的产品经理能够更清晰地梳理问题,制定更为合理的解决方案。
2、对功能的敏锐度:
技术人员对产品的功能有着深入的了解和敏锐的洞察力。他们能够准确地把握用户需求的演变过程,并考虑到功能的颗粒度,从而设计出更符合用户需求的产品。
3、与研发团队的顺畅沟通:
由于技术人员具备技术背景,他们能够与研发团队进行更为顺畅的沟通。他们能够快速理解研发团队的需求和想法,同时也能够将自己的产品理念准确地传达给研发团队,从而推动项目的顺利进行。
4、擅长项目管理:
技术人员往往具备较强的项目管理能力,他们能够对项目进度有清晰的把握,避免被开发团队“忽悠”。通过提前评估需求的可行性和工时的合理性,技术人员出身的产品经理能够更有效地提升工作效率,确保项目按时按质完成。
5、成本效益意识:
技术人员出身的产品经理在没资源的时候可以用最低成本把事情办好,有资源的时候可以把资源用的更有效率。他们通常能够从技术的角度出发,考虑如何在保证产品质量的前提下降低成本,提高企业的经济效益。
技术转岗产品经理的劣势主要体现在以下几个方面:
1、思维方式差异:
技术人员往往从技术视角出发,而产品经理则需要具备用户视角。这种思维方式的转变对于技术人员来说是一大挑战,因为他们可能缺乏对用户、场景和痛点的敏感度,难以从用户的根本需求出发来思考和设计产品。
2、过于强调技术:
技术人员在转岗为产品经理后,可能会过于关注技术解决方案的完美性,而忽视了产品的市场接受度和用户体验。这可能导致产品过于复杂或难以使用,从而影响产品的市场竞争力。
3、缺乏产品实践经验:
技术人员在转岗前通常没有直接参与过产品的设计、开发和推广过程,因此缺乏相关的实践经验。这可能导致他们在面对实际产品问题时感到无从下手,难以做出有效的决策。
4、运营和审美能力不足:
技术人员往往对运营、市场等相关领域了解不够深入,同时可能缺乏交互设计、视觉设计等方面的知识和技能。这些能力的缺失可能限制他们在产品经理岗位上的发挥,尤其是在制定产品策略和推广计划时。
5、陷入技术细节:
由于技术人员具备强大的逻辑能力,他们可能会在产品设计和开发过程中过于陷入技术细节,而忽视了产品的整体性和用户体验。这可能导致产品开发周期延长,成本增加,甚至影响产品的最终质量。
程序员如何转行产品经理?
程序员转行产品经理是一个需要综合考虑多方面因素的过程。以下是一些建议,帮助程序员顺利转行产品经理:
1、了解产品经理的职责和要求:
①产品经理负责产品策划、需求分析、市场调研、用户体验设计、项目管理等多方面的工作。
②需要具备项目管理、市场分析、用户体验设计等方面的知识和技能。
2、学习产品管理相关知识:
①可以通过参加培训课程、在线学习平台或阅读相关书籍,深入了解产品管理的理论和实践知识。推荐书籍如《启示录:打造用户喜爱的产品》、《用户体验要素》等。
②推荐考取NPDP证书。产品经理国际资格认证NPDP(NewProduct Development Professional),新产品开发专业人士认证,由美国产品开发与管理协会(PDMA)发起,目前是国际上公认的在新产品开发领域最具权威的国际认证,也是国际公认的唯一在新产品开发领域专业认证,集理论、方法与实践为一体的全方位知识体系。(送备考资料。联系我们:18938656370)
3、培养全局观念:
①程序员需要学会从全局角度看待产品和项目的整体运营,而不仅仅是关注技术实现。
②要了解产品的生命周期,包括需求分析、产品设计、开发、测试、发布、运营和迭代等各个环节。
4、提升沟通与领导能力:
①产品经理需要与多个团队协作,包括研发、设计、市场、运营等。
②程序员需要提升沟通技巧,学会清晰地表达需求、目标和进度,解决团队间的沟通障碍。
③同时,也要培养领导能力,能够激励团队成员,调动大家的积极性。
5、积累产品经验:
①主动参与公司内部的产品项目,协助产品经理进行需求分析、产品规划等工作。
②通过实践积累产品管理经验,了解产品经理的工作流程和方法。
6、掌握数据分析技能:
①在数字化时代,数据分析能力对于产品经理来说至关重要。
②程序员可以通过学习数据分析工具,如Excel、Tableau等,提升数据处理和分析能力。
③通过数据分析来指导产品决策、评估产品效果。
7、建立用户反馈机制:
①用户反馈是产品经理了解用户需求和产品问题的重要来源。
②程序员需要学会通过多种渠道收集用户反馈,如用户评论、社交媒体、用户调研等。
③并有效地整理和分析这些反馈信息,识别用户的核心需求和痛点。
9、培养创新思维:
①创新思维是产品经理的重要素质之一。
②程序员可以通过用户导向创新、技术驱动创新和跨界思维等方式,不断寻找新的产品机会和改进方法。
9、建立专业人脉:
①参加行业会议、沙龙、培训等活动,结识更多的行业专家和同行。
②加入专业的产品经理社群,获取最新的行业动态和知识,提升专业水平。
10、寻求导师指导:
①寻找一位有经验的产品经理作为导师,可以提供宝贵的经验和建议。
②导师可以帮助解决在实际工作中遇到的问题,更快地成长。
综上所述,程序员转行产品经理需要全面了解产品管理、培养全局观念、提升沟通与领导能力、积累产品经验、掌握数据分析技能、建立用户反馈机制、培养创新思维和建立专业人脉等多方面的努力。通过不断学习和实践,程序员可以成功转型为一名优秀的产品经理。